The Mississippi: America's Mainstream is the first comprehensive history of the river from its earliest days as a vital trade route to the present. The book tells the story of the people, politics, and environment of the Mississippi River Valley from the earliest human settlements to the present. Louis Solomon uses rich archival sources and interviews with leading historians to provide a unique perspective on the river and the people who have shaped it.; Photographs and Line Drawings; 4to; 128 pages; TBC.
